## Contractor Access — First Week

Contractors joining Velmora Systems at the Brackenfield site collect a temporary lanyard from the ground-floor welcome desk on day one. The lanyard opens the main atrium and Block C workshops only. Lift access to floors 3–5 requires escort until your induction is signed off by your site sponsor, usually by Wednesday. Parking passes are handled separately by the transport office. Once your induction is complete, use the following pass code at the turnstiles:

badge for hahip-bagag: bdg-FIJ-9

Customers configure watering windows per plant profile, and the scheduler dispatches reminders through the Fernwick notification layer. Most tickets involve missed reminders; always check whether the customer's timezone matches their profile settings before escalating. If a schedule appears frozen, ask the customer to re-sync from the app's settings page and note the result in the ticket. For anything involving data loss or billing, escalate to the Greenhouse tier directly.

escalation mailbox, bafog-fafog: ulador@paliqlabs.internal

Subject: DR drill next Thursday — Splitmatic assignment service

Hi,

Quick heads-up before the release freeze: we're running a disaster-recovery drill on Splitmatic, the A/B experiment assignment service. Expect a brief window where assignments fall back to cached buckets. If you need to restore the config vault yourself during the drill, the restore prompt takes the passphrase below.

unlock words, hahip-baduf: holwyn-istath-julvan